If you are following the same design that Heikki put forward, then there is
a problem with it in maintaining the bits in page and the bits in visibility
map in sync, which we have already discussed.

Are you referring to this: http://archives.postgresql.org/pgsql-hackers/2010-02/msg02097.php ? I believe Robert's changes to make the visibility map crash-safe covers that. Clearing the bit in the visibility map now happens within the same critical section as clearing the flag on the heap page and writing th WAL record.
